The School of Music at the University of Leeds brings together internationally acclaimed scholars, composers and performers, to set the highest standards in music research and postgraduate teaching. It is one of the largest academic schools of its kind in the country, and offers supervision and taught programmes across a wide range of undergraduate and research interests.

Undergraduate Programmes
BA with Year in Industry allows students in the School of Music to spend their third year working on placement in the music industry.BA Music focuses on Western art music in a course that encourages personal and intellectual development.
BA Popular and World Musics focuses on a wide range of popular and traditional music forms from around the globe.
BMus Music Performance 'Abroad' is an exciting four-year degree specialising in performance.
